Hawkinsville is 10-0 against Treutlen since August of 2019, and they'll have a chance to extend that success on Tuesday. The Hawkinsville Red Devils will look to defend their home field against the Treutlen Vikings at 5:30 p.m. The timing is sure in Hawkinsville's favor as the squad sits on three straight wins at home while Treutlen has been banged up by four consecutive losses on the road.
Hawkinsville is probably headed into the matchup with a chip on their shoulder considering Schley County just ended the team's five-game winning streak on Monday. They fell 7-4 to the Wildcats.
Meanwhile, Treutlen fell victim to Wheeler County and their airtight pitching crew on Thursday. They came up short against the Bulldogs, falling 13-0.
Hawkinsville's defeat ended a three-game streak of away wins and brought them to 9-4. As for Treutlen, their loss dropped their record down to 1-7.
Hawkinsville took their victory against Treutlen when the teams last played back in October of 2023 by a conclusive 17-0. Does Hawkinsville have another victory up their sleeve, or will Treutlen tur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
